IndyCar should look overseas and to ovals in the future
IndyCar has always been a predominantly North American-based series, with only a small selection of races being held overseas. However, with IndyCar’s popularity gathering significant momentum both in America and internationally, the burning question is should the sport adapt and re-introduce several overseas races? Esteemed team owner Roger Penske recently hit out against such an idea, as well as adding more races to the IndyCar calendar. 'I would like to have 15 or 16 good races,' explained Roger Penske to reporters. 'I don't want to have 18, 19 or 20. I'm not interested in going overseas.
